文档导航
API 文档/AI检测 API

AI检测 API

检测文本是否由AI生成,返回AI生成概率和详细分析结果。支持中英文文本检测。

接口信息

请求方法

POST

接口地址

https://api.lunwenj.com/api/v1/open/v1/check-ai/analyze

计费方式

按字数计费:1.5元/千字

请求参数

参数名类型必填说明默认值
contentstring待检测的文本内容-

代码示例

curl -X POST https://api.lunwenj.com/api/v1/open/v1/check-ai/analyze \
  -H "Content-Type: application/json" \
  -H "X-API-Key: ak_xxx.sk_xxx" \
  -d '{
  "content": "人工智能(Artificial Intelligence,简称AI)是计算机科学的一个分支,它企图了解智能的实质,并生产出一种新的能以人类智能相似的方式做出反应的智能机器..."
}'

响应示例

成功响应

{
  "code": 200,
  "message": "ok",
  "data": {
    "request_id": "req_chk456def",
    "ai_probability": 85.2,
    "overall_ai_rate": 85.2,
    "ai_words": 1022,
    "word_count": 1200,
    "cost": 1.80,
    "balance": 98.20,
    "segments": [
      {
        "text": "人工智能(Artificial Intelligence,简称AI)是计算机科学的一个分支...",
        "ai_probability": 0.86,
        "start": 0,
        "end": 68,
        "level": "high"
      }
    ],
    "created_at": "2024-01-15T16:00:00Z"
  }
}

返回参数

字段名类型说明
codeinteger业务状态码,成功固定返回 200。
messagestring响应消息,成功时通常为 ok。
dataobject接口返回的业务数据对象。
data.request_idstring本次检测请求的唯一标识。
data.ai_probabilitynumber整体 AI 概率,百分比形式。
data.overall_ai_ratenumber整体 AI 率,通常与 ai_probability 一致。
data.ai_wordsinteger估算的 AI 文本字数。
data.segmentsobject[]分段检测结果列表。
data.segments[].textstring当前分段的原始文本。
data.segments[].ai_probabilitynumber当前分段的 AI 概率,0 到 1。
data.segments[].startinteger当前分段在原文中的起始位置。
data.segments[].endinteger当前分段在原文中的结束位置。
data.segments[].levelstring风险等级,如 low、medium、high。
data.word_countinteger参与检测的文本字数。
data.costnumber本次调用实际消费金额,单位元。
data.balancenumber调用完成后的账户剩余余额,单位元。
data.created_atstring(datetime)请求完成时间,UTC 时间字符串。

错误码

错误码说明
400文本过短,至少需要 15 字
402账户余额不足
403API Key 无效或已禁用
429超出并发限制,请稍后重试

接口介绍

AI 检测 API 支持对文本进行整体 AI 概率与分段风险分析。

适用场景

适用于审核系统、论文检测工具和内容质量平台接入。

接入流程

提交待检测文本,系统返回整体概率、风险等级和分段结果。